Prerequisites: What You Need to Get Started
Before you dive into connecting your Shopify store with Facebook, there are several essential elements you need to have in place:
- A Shopify Store: You must have an active Shopify account that is at least on the Basic plan level.
- Facebook Account: Ensure you have a personal Facebook account.
- Facebook Business Page: You'll need a dedicated Business Page for your brand on Facebook.
- Facebook Business Manager Account: This account helps you manage Facebook assets associated with your business.
- Facebook Ad Account: To create ads and monitor performance, an Ads account is essential.
- Facebook Pixel: If you want to track user interactions and conversions, installing a Facebook Pixel is crucial.
Once you have these components ready, we can move forward with the connection process.
How to Connect Your Shopify Store to Facebook
Connecting your Shopify store to Facebook can be done in a few straightforward steps. Follow along to get your Facebook link added seamlessly.
Step 1: Prepare Your Facebook Business Manager
- Go to business.facebook.com and click on "Create Account."
- Fill in your business details such as the name and applicable business information.
- Link your Facebook Page to the Business Manager by following the prompts provided.
Step 2: Add the Facebook Sales Channel in Shopify
- In your Shopify admin dashboard, navigate to Settings > Apps and sales channels.
- Click on the Shopify App Store, search for Facebook & Instagram, and click on Add app.
Step 3: Connect Your Facebook Account
- Within Shopify, select the newly added Facebook sales channel.
- Click on Start setup, then Connect account.
- Log in to your Facebook account, allowing the necessary permissions for Instagram, Pages, Ad Accounts, and Pixels.
- Review and accept Facebook’s terms, then click Finish setup.
Step 4: Set Up Your Facebook Shop
- Choose your preferred checkout method (either directly via Facebook or redirect to Shopify).
- Select the product catalog you wish to sync between Shopify and Facebook.
- Agree to Facebook’s commerce policies and submit your shop for review.
Step 5: Sync Your Products
- Return to Shopify and navigate to Facebook > Overview > View Products.
- Select the products you want to be visible on your Facebook shop.
- Ensure images are optimized (preferably square) for the best display quality.
Step 6: Final Review and Launch
- Allow Facebook some time to approve your shop after submission (usually takes a few hours to days). Once approved, you’re ready to go!
It is essential to keep your stock updated in both settings. Monitor products regularly to ensure they reflect any changes made in Shopify.
How to Add a "Shop Now" Button on Your Facebook Page
A great way to increase traffic back to your Shopify store from Facebook is by adding a "Shop Now" button to your Business Page.
Steps to Add the Button:
- Navigate to your Facebook Business Page.
- Click the + Add a Button option below your cover photo.
- Select Shop Now or View Shop from the given options.
- Paste your Shopify store URL into the provided link field.
- Click Save to finalize and make the button live on your page.
This simple button serves as a direct call to action, facilitating users toward your Shopify products effortlessly.
Adding a Facebook Button to Your Shopify Store
To enhance customer engagement and connectivity, displaying a Facebook link on your Shopify store is beneficial. Here’s how to do it:
Steps to Integrate the Facebook Link:
- Log in to your Shopify admin dashboard.
- Go to Online Store > Themes, and then click Customize for your active theme.
- Navigate to the Footer, Header, or Theme Settings, depending on your chosen theme.
- Search for sections labeled Social Media or Social Links, or create a custom content block where you can add a link.
- Enter your Facebook Page URL or utilize a built-in Facebook icon if available.
- Save changes to make the Facebook icon visible.
Now, customers will have a straightforward way to access your Facebook Page directly while browsing your store!

Troubleshooting Common Issues
While setting up the integration may be straightforward, you might encounter some challenges. Here are solutions to common issues:
- Product Sync Errors: Ensure your products meet Facebook's guidelines and have complete descriptions. Double-check for any omitted information.
- Approval Delays: If your shop is taking longer than expected to get approved, re-examine your business information and product entries for accuracy.
- Pixel Tracking Issues: Verify that you have the correct Pixel installed and functioning. Check that data sharing settings are enabled.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. How do I connect Shopify to Facebook?
To connect Shopify to Facebook, install the Facebook & Instagram app in Shopify, log into your Facebook account, and follow the prompts to set up your shop.
2. Do I need a Facebook Business Manager account?
Yes, a Facebook Business Manager is necessary for managing your business assets, which include your Facebook Page and Ad Account.
3. Will my products sync automatically?
Yes, once connected, your products will sync automatically between Shopify and your Facebook shop.
4. Can I run Facebook ads through Shopify?
Absolutely! You can create and manage Facebook and Instagram ads directly from your Shopify dashboard.
5. How long does Facebook take to review my shop?
Typically, Facebook reviews shops within a few hours to a couple of days, provided all information submitted is accurate.
